    Unable to tune BBCHD/BBC1HD

    If I try to manually scan on 28E for 10847V 22000 3/4 I get a signal strength reading of 90% and quality zero.
    On adjacent transponders such as 10788V,10832H, 10862H,10875V strength and quality are around 90%/85% and everything else is fine. No prob with other HD channels.
    The DECT phone has been switched off (in case that was a cause) and although I haven't changed the LNB yet could that be the problem?

    Would backing up the channel list and performing a complete re-scan of 28E help?

    don't know the box, if you can set Fec to Auto or Fec individual: 1/2 3/4 5/6 ... If wrong fec is set, can imagine it wont open stream as you tell to read 3/4 and not read others.
    I get a signal strength reading of 90% and quality zero
    could be a symptom for having a wrong Fec, as strong signal is received other parameters mentioned did fit (or your reading the wrong satellite)

    Situation resolved.

    Fed the 28E LNB direct to the receiver (no DiSEqc switch used) - no difference.
    Took the receiver to a friends to try on a Sky dish - transponder tuned in.
    Replaced the LNB on my dish and used DiSEqc switch - everything back to normal
